Strategic Font Pairing for Modern Typography Layouts

To maximize the impact of Bursting, it is essential to pair it with complementary typefaces that ensure overall readability and balance. A common mistake in editorial design is pairing two decorative fonts, which creates visual noise and confusion. Instead, combine Bursting with a highly legible serif font for body paragraphs to maintain a classic, editorial feel, or pair it with a geometric sans serif for a modern, clean contrast. This combination allows the unique and beautiful touch of every letter in Bursting to shine without overwhelming the reader. For web design and mobile layouts, ensuring that the body font has sufficient line height and spacing is critical when the headings utilize a flowing script. This balance supports accessibility standards while maintaining the artistic integrity of the Script Handwritten aesthetic.
